Trina Hackensmith joined Lyon Software in February, 2006. With a background in finance, computer networking and customer relations, she initially served in technical and customer support. Within several months, Trina transitioned into training hospitals, health systems, senior living communities, and colleges and universities how to use Lyon Software's CBISA™ (Community Benefit Inventory for Social Accountability) program. She is now a Vice President and lead trainer for Lyon Software and enjoys travelling around the country meeting and training community benefit champions.
Trina has served as an educator on Social Accountability and Community Benefit at national and state conferences, including pre-conference and breakout sessions. Trina has also served on the Catholic Health Association's What Counts Advisory Group since its inception providing community benefit reporting guidance to the field.
Trina graduated from Liberty University in 1986 with a Bachelor of Science degree in finance and enjoyed a long career in the mortgage banking industry prior to joining Lyon Software.
